Bamurru Plains on the Mary River floodplains is Australia’s answer to the Okavango Delta. These coastal floodplains are home to prolific bird and wildlife, with almost a third of Australia’s species present, whilst nearby Kakadu and Arnhem Land are the heartland of Australia’s indigenous culture. This is the setting for a mesmerising Wild Bush Luxury experience.

Bamurru Plains offers one of Australia’s richest wildlife experiences: tens of thousands of magpie geese mingle with kites, egrets, herons and buffalo on the floodplain. Kookaburras, parrots, cockatoos and Agile Wallabies inhabit the fringing woodlands. Bamurru’s expert guides offer exhilarating airboat trips on the floodplains, safaris by open-top 4WD vehicles, fishing trips, quad bike safaris, guided wilderness walks, crocodile-spotting river cruises and excursions to ancient rock art galleries in Kakadu.

Wake to the call of magpie geese and watch the parade of wildlife emerge from the comfort of your bed. Spot wildlife from six metres high in the treetops from the ‘hide’, and sit back with a drink and enjoy the soft ‘Wild Bush Luxury’ touches. The safari lodge and 300 square kilometres of surrounding country are exclusively for in-house guests, assuring a quiet, privileged
outback experience.

Bamurru’s team of passionate field guides focus on immersing guests in the story of the bush while the lodge provides a haven from which to closely connect with a unique Top End wilderness and with just ten safari suites blending seamlessly into the surrounding bush, you’ll forget there is an outside world.
